17 Bible Verses about Those Who Committed Adultery

Most Relevant Verses

Jeremiah 5:7

How shall I pardon thee for this? Thy sons have forsaken me and sworn by them that are not gods: when I had fed them to the full, they then committed adultery and assembled themselves by troops in the harlots' houses.

Hosea 7:4

They are all adulterers as an oven heated by the baker who shall cease from waking after he has kneaded the dough until it is leavened.

Jeremiah 23:14

I have also seen a horrible thing in the prophets of Jerusalem: they committed adultery and walked by lies; they strengthened also the hands of evildoers, that no none is converted from his malice; they are all of them unto me as Sodom and the inhabitants thereof as Gomorrah.

John 8:3

Then the scribes and Pharisees brought unto him a woman taken in adultery, and when they had set her in the midst,

Judges 19:2

And his concubine committed adultery against him and went away from him unto her father's house to Bethlehem of Judah and was there four whole months.

Proverbs 9:17

Stolen waters are sweet, and bread eaten in secret is pleasant.

Hosea 1:2

The beginning of the word of the LORD with Hosea. And the LORD said to Hosea, Go, take unto thee a wife of whoredoms and children of whoredoms: for the land shall give itself over to whoredom by departing from the LORD.

Romans 2:22

Thou that sayest a man should not commit adultery, dost thou commit adultery? Thou that dost abhor idols, dost thou commit sacrilege?

Jeremiah 7:9

Will ye steal, murder, and commit adultery, and swear falsely, and burn incense unto Baal, and walk after other gods whom ye know not,

Psalm 50:18

When thou didst see a thief, then thou didst consent with him and hast been partaker with adulterers.

Ezekiel 33:26

Ye stand upon your sword, ye work abomination, and ye defile each one his neighbour's wife, and shall ye possess the land?

Hosea 4:2

By swearing and lying and murdering and stealing and committing adultery, they prevailed, and blood touches blood.

Hosea 4:13

They sacrifice upon the tops of the mountains and burn incense upon the hills, under oaks and poplars and elms, that had good shade; therefore your daughters shall commit whoredom, and your daughters-in-law shall commit adultery.

Matthew 1:6

Jesse begat David the king; David the king begat Solomon of her that had been the wife of Urias;

John 8:4

they said unto him, Master, this woman was taken in adultery in the very act.

Revelation 2:22

Behold, I will cast her into a bed and those that commit adultery with her into great tribulation unless they repent of their deeds.
